#dd5262 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dd5262 is composed of 86.7% red, 32.2%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 62.9% magenta, 55.7%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 353.1 degrees, a saturation of 67.1% and a lightness of 59.4%. #dd5262 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a4c4 with #bb0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

#dd5262 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dd5262 has RGB values of R:221, G:82, B:98 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.63, Y:0.56,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14504546.

Shades and Tints of #dd5262
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070102 is the darkest color, while #fdf6f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#dd5262
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9d9293 is the less saturated color, while #fd3249 is the most saturated one.
